At Esatcom Inc., we offer a comprehensive range of amplifiers and converters from trusted manufacturers to optimize the performance of your satellite communication systems.
Our selection includes BUCs, TWTAs, LNAs, SSPAs, and more, designed to ensure seamless signal transmission, amplification, and conversion across various satellite bands (C, Ku, Ka).
Whether you need frequency converters, power amplifiers, or signal processing solutions, our products help enhance signal quality, reduce noise, and improve system efficiency.
Explore our solutions for broadcasting, telecommunications, remote site communications, and earth stations to ensure robust, high-quality satellite connectivity.
